WebApr 12, 2024 · In addition to the well-known shortage of registered nurses, those working in hospitals can make $10,000 to $20,000 more yearly than school nurses. How Much Do School Nurses Make? The starting salary of a school nurse in 2024 is $40,550 a year, and the average salary is $60,730 a year. School Nurses Enjoy Their Time Off!
